KENNINGTON PAROCHIAL CHARITY

REPORT OF THE TRUSTEES FOR THE YEAR ENDED 31 MARCH 2025

The trustees present their report with the financial statements of the charity for the year ended 31 March 2025. The trustees have adopted the provisions of Accounting and Reporting by Charities: Statement of Recommended Practice applicable to charities preparing their accounts in accordance with the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land (FRS 102) (effective 1 January 2019).

OBJECTIVES AND ACTIVITIES

Objectives and aims

The objects of the charity are as follows : a) Provision of allotments for the poor. b) Provision of almshouses for the needy.

c) For the benefit of residents in the almhouses of the charity.

d) To relieve either generally or individually needy persons resident in the area of benefit.

Activities

Housing owned by the Charity is maintained and rented, together with income generated from cash and investments so as to be assured that the long term objective can be met.

ACHIEVEMENT AND PERFORMANCE

Going concern

After making appropriate enquiries, the Trustees have a reasonable expectation that the charity has adequate resources to continue in operational existence for the foreseeable future. For this reason they continue to adopt the going concern basis in preparing the financial statements. Further details regarding the adoption of the going concern basis can be found in Accounting Policies.

Review of activities

Incoming resources for the year amounted to £31,295 (2024 - £28,418). Resources expended amounted to £6,344 (2024 - £8,738). This has resulted in a surplus for the year of £24,951 (2024 - £19,680).

The Trustees confirm that they have referred to the guidance contained in the Charity Commission's general guidance on public benefit when reviewing the Trust's aims and objectives and in planning future activities.

Investments are shown at market value at the date of the accounts.

FINANCIAL REVIEW

Reserves policy

The Trustees have reviewed the general reserves held by the charity and feel that they are not excessive. The trustees also feel that the general reserves should represent at least 1 month's expected general expenditure. The trustees continue to seek alternative investments for the charity, and are in consultation with Charity Commission. In the meantime, excess cash has been invested on long term deposits and an investment portfolio to realise the maximum interest available.

STRUCTURE, GOVERNANCE AND MANAGEMENT Governing document

The charity is controlled by its governing document, a deed of trust and constitutes an unincorporated charity.

Under schemes established by the Charities Commissioners on 6 September 1910 and 27 February 1934, investment formerly administered as assets of "United Charities" were to be administered as assets of Kennington Parochial Charities.

Organisational structure

The Trustees of Kennington Parochial Charities are responsible for the general control and management of the administration of the charity. The Board of Trustees is made up of six members, one of whom must be a vicar, two of which are appointed by the Council, and the remaining two are voted for by the Board of Trustees.

KENNINGTON PAROCHIAL CHARITY

NOTES TO THE FINANCIAL STATEMENTS FOR THE YEAR ENDED 31 MARCH 2025

1. ACCOUNTING POLICIES

Basis of preparing the financial statements

The financial statements of the charity, which is a public benefit entity under FRS 102, have been prepared in accordance with the Charities SORP (FRS 102) 'Accounting and Reporting by Charities: Statement of Recommended Practice applicable to charities preparing their accounts in accordance with the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land (FRS 102) (effective 1 January 2019)', Financial Reporting Standard 102 'The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land' and the Charities Act 2011. The financial statements have been prepared under the historical cost convention, as modified by the revaluation of certain assets.

Income

All income is recognised in the Statement of Financial Activities once the charity has entitlement to the funds, it is probable that the income will be received and the amount can be measured reliably.

Expenditure

Liabilities are recognised as expenditure as soon as there is a legal or constructive obligation committing the charity to that expenditure, it is probable that a transfer of economic benefits will be required in settlement and the amount of the obligation can be measured reliably. Expenditure is accounted for on an accruals basis and has been classified under headings that aggregate all cost related to the category. Where costs cannot be directly attributed to particular headings they have been allocated to activities on a basis consistent with the use of resources.

Investment property

Investment property is shown at most recent valuation. Any aggregate surplus or deficit arising from changes in fair value is recognised in the Statement of Financial Activities.

Taxation

The charity is exempt from tax on its charitable activities.

Fund accounting

Unrestricted funds can be used in accordance with the charitable objectives at the discretion of the trustees.

Restricted funds can only be used for particular restricted purposes within the objects of the charity. Restrictions arise when specified by the donor or when funds are raised for particular restricted purposes.

Further explanation of the nature and purpose of each fund is included in the notes to the financial statements.
